-
sql-server – 实体框架缓存查询计划性能随着不同参数而降低
所属栏目:[MsSql教程] 日期:2021-01-22 热度:79
副标题#e# 我有以下问题. 背景 我正在尝试使用MVC3,EF4和jquery在450万条记录的表上实现自动完成选择器. 这是表: CREATE TABLE [dbo].[CONSTA] ( [afpCUIT] nvarchar(11) COLLATE Modern_Spanish_CI_AS NOT NULL,[afpNombre] nvarchar(30) COLLATE Modern_[详细]
-
sql-server – 在SQL Server中设计条件数据库关系
所属栏目:[MsSql教程] 日期:2021-01-22 热度:60
副标题#e# 我有三种基本类型的实体:人员,企业和资产.每个资产可以由一个且仅一个人或企业拥有.每个人员和企业可以拥有0到多个资产.在Microsoft SQL Server中存储此类条件关系的最佳做法是什么? 我最初的计划是在Assets表中有两个可以为空的外键,一个用于P[详细]
-
有效地包含不在SQL查询的Group By中的列
所属栏目:[MsSql教程] 日期:2021-01-21 热度:80
特定 表A. Id INTEGERName VARCHAR(50) 表B. Id INTEGERFkId INTEGER ; Foreign key to Table A 我想计算每个FkId值的出现次数: SELECT FkId,COUNT(FkId) FROM B GROUP BY FkId 现在我只想输出表A中的Name. 这不起作用: SELECT FkId,COUNT(FkId),a.NameF[详细]
-
sql – 与在MS Access数据库中加入相关的问题
所属栏目:[MsSql教程] 日期:2021-01-21 热度:128
我在MS Access数据库中使用以下查询: SELECT SD.RollNo,SD.Name,ED.ExamName,( SELECT count(*) FROM ( SELECT DISTINCT innerED.StudentId FROM ExamDetails innerED WHERE innerED.StudentId=SD.StudentId )) AS StudentIdFROM StudentDetails SD LEFT[详细]
-
azure – 如何在文档数据库中上载多个文档(批量)
所属栏目:[MsSql教程] 日期:2021-01-21 热度:194
我有文件列表(对象),该对象有多个文件,即Json记录存在,但是当我尝试上传文件串(记录)时,它不会上传到文档数据库,但是当我上传单个文档记录时,它会成功上传. ListMyModelClass listObj = new ListMyModelClass(); Document doc = await DocumentClient.Crea[详细]
-
sql-server-2008 – 使用PIVOT SQL Server 2008时更改列名
所属栏目:[MsSql教程] 日期:2021-01-21 热度:82
SELECT * FROM EmployeeAttributesPIVOT ( MAX(VALUE) FOR AttributeID IN ([DD14C4C2-FC9E-4A2E-9B96-C6A20A169B2E],[BE8149E2-0806-4D59-8482-58223C2F1735],[23B2C459-3D30-41CA-92AE-7F581F2535D4]) ) P 结果 EmployeeID DD14C4C2-FC9E-4A2E-9B96-C6A2[详细]
-
sql-server – 如何分配SqlException编号
所属栏目:[MsSql教程] 日期:2021-01-21 热度:178
SqlException具有属性Number. 然后有这个:http://msdn.microsoft.com/en-us/library/cc645603.aspx 这个:http://msdn.microsoft.com/en-us/library/windows/desktop/ms681382(v=vs.85).aspx 它似乎是一个或另一个 题: 怎么决定哪个? 要求的原因: 我需[详细]
-
SQL内部联接空值
所属栏目:[MsSql教程] 日期:2021-01-21 热度:105
我加入了 SELECT * FROM YINNER JOIN X ON ISNULL(X.QID,0) = ISNULL(y.QID,0) 像这样的连接中的Isnull会让它变慢.这就像有条件的加入. 有什么工作可以解决这个问题吗? 我有很多记录,其中QID是空的 任何人都有一个解决方案,不需要修改数据 解决方法 你有[详细]
-
sql-server – 您可以在数据透视表中小计行和/或列吗?
所属栏目:[MsSql教程] 日期:2021-01-21 热度:195
我有一组输出数据透视表的查询.是否可以获得数据透视表的行和/或列小计? 我选择的桌子看起来像这样 Site FormID Present Site 1 Form A Yes Site 1 Form B Yes Site 1 Form D Yes 等等… 我的数据透视表查询是这样的 SELECT * FROM (SELECT Site,COUNT(Fo[详细]
-
你能在SQL中定义“文字”表吗?
所属栏目:[MsSql教程] 日期:2021-01-21 热度:121
是否有任何SQL子查询语法允许您从字面上定义临时表? 例如,像 SELECT MAX(count) AS max,COUNT(*) AS countFROM ( (1 AS id,7 AS count),(2,6),(3,13),(4,12),(5,9) ) AS mytable INNER JOIN someothertable ON someothertable.id=mytable.id 这将节省必须[详细]
-
sql – 从表中找出第n个最高薪水
所属栏目:[MsSql教程] 日期:2021-01-21 热度:155
name salary----- -----mohan 500ram 1000dinesh 5000hareesh 6000mallu 7500manju 7500praveen 10000hari 10000 如何使用Oracle从上述表中找到第n个最高薪水? 解决方法 你可以使用这样的东西..这是我测试过,然后粘贴在这里 SELECT *FROM tblnameWHERE sa[详细]
-
数据库设计 – 在具有缩写表名的表中为每个字段名添加前缀是一个
所属栏目:[MsSql教程] 日期:2021-01-21 热度:157
您是否在具有缩写表名的表中为每个字段添加前缀? 例: Table: UserFields:user_iduser_nameuser_password 或者你是否将你的田地命名为最低限度? Fields:idnamepassword 如果您同时使用了这两种格式,那么从长远来看,您觉得哪种格式对您最有帮助? 编辑:[详细]
-
SQL事件探查器可以在查询旁边显示返回结果集吗?
所属栏目:[MsSql教程] 日期:2021-01-21 热度:93
在SQL事件探查器2005中,是否可以在SQL跟踪中捕获结果集,以便我可以看到带有结果集的相应查询? ……或者它只是一种单向痕迹? 谢谢! 乔治 解决方法 不,您无法获取SQL跟踪中包含的查询生成的结果集.您只能告诉有关呼叫的各种统计信息(即执行的查询,持续时[详细]
-
在关系数据库中存储R对象
所属栏目:[MsSql教程] 日期:2021-01-20 热度:190
我经常在从关系数据库中提取的数据上创建非参数统计(黄土,内核密度等).为了使数据管理更容易,我想将R输出存储在我的数据库中.使用简单的数字或文本数据框很容易,但我还没有弄清楚如何将R对象存储回我的关系数据库中.那么有没有办法将内核密度的向量存储回[详细]
-
sql – 使用IN Clause在动态查询中需要帮助
所属栏目:[MsSql教程] 日期:2021-01-20 热度:171
我有1个表,它被命名为ProductMaster.另一个表是VendorMaster.现在我想找到指定Vendormaster的所有产品. 所以我想使用SQL Server的IN子句. 我将以逗号分隔格式传递VendorName.例如HP,LENOVO 我使用函数“f_split”以逗号(,)作为分隔符拆分字符串. 我必须生[详细]
-
使用未确定数量的参数时,如何避免动态SQL?
所属栏目:[MsSql教程] 日期:2021-01-20 热度:135
我有一个类似StackOverflow的标记系统,用于我正在处理的数据库.我正在编写一个存储过程,根据WHERE子句中未确定数量的标记查找结果.可以有0到10个标签之间的任何位置来过滤结果.例如,用户可能正在搜索标记为“apple”,“orange”和“banana”的项目,并且每[详细]
-
ms-access – 如何控制Access数据库的用户权限?
所属栏目:[MsSql教程] 日期:2021-01-20 热度:97
允许一个用户写访问权限以及其他人对本地网络上的MS Access数据库进行只读访问的最简单方法是什么? 我相信我的用户,但不幸的是,只要取消选择表的行,Access就会保存对数据的更改.保存意外击键,用户不要求保存更改. 解决方法 最简单的方法是使用共享权限.授[详细]
-
使用SQL逐字翻译字符串
所属栏目:[MsSql教程] 日期:2021-01-20 热度:149
我需要在句子或字符串中反转单词的位置. For example : "Hello World! I Love StackOverflow",to be displayed as "StackOverflow Love I World! Hello". 可以用SQL完成吗?字长不大于VARCHAR2(4000),它是Oracle VARCHAR2表列中的最大长度支持. 我得到了用[详细]
-
如何使用SQL MAX函数获取行的所有字段?
所属栏目:[MsSql教程] 日期:2021-01-20 热度:131
考虑这个表(从 http://www.tizag.com/mysqlTutorial/mysqlmax.php): Id name type price 123451 Park's Great Hits Music 19.99 123452 Silly Puddy Toy 3.99 123453 Playstation Toy 89.95 123454 Men's T-Shirt Clothing 32.50 123455 Blouse Clothing[详细]
-
带有last_insert_id()的Mysql多行插入 – 选择语句
所属栏目:[MsSql教程] 日期:2021-01-20 热度:176
好.所以缺点是,我试图做一个INSERT SELECT,例如: START TRANSACTION; INSERT INTO dbNEW.entity (commonName,surname) SELECT namefirst,namelast FROM dbOLD.user; SET @key = LAST_INSERT_ID(); INSERT INTO dbNEW.user (userID,entityID,other) SELECT[详细]
-
使用bcp将csv文件导入sql 2005或2008
所属栏目:[MsSql教程] 日期:2021-01-20 热度:136
我有一个csv文件,我需要将它导入sql 2005或2008中的表.csv中的列名和计数与表列名和计数不同. csv被’;’拆分. 例 CSV FILE内容: FirstName;LastName;Country;AgeRoger;Mouthout;Belgium;55 SQL人员表 Columns: FName,LName,Country 解决方法 我创建了一[详细]
-
sql-server – 我有关于死锁的数据,但我无法理解它们为什么会发
所属栏目:[MsSql教程] 日期:2021-01-20 热度:91
副标题#e# 我在我的大型Web应用程序中收到了很多死锁. How to automatically re-run deadlocked transaction? (ASP.NET MVC/SQL Server) 在这里,我想重新运行死锁事务,但我被告知要摆脱僵局 – 它比试图赶上死锁要好得多. 所以我花了一整天的时间用SQL Prof[详细]
-
sql – 从父表和子表中删除行
所属栏目:[MsSql教程] 日期:2021-01-20 热度:68
假设Oracle 10G中有两个表 TableA (Parent) -- TableB (Child) TableA中的每一行都有几个与它相关的子行. 我想删除TableA中的特定行,这意味着我必须首先删除tableB中的相关行. 这会删除子条目 delete from tableB where last_update_Dtm = sysdate-30; 要[详细]
-
sql – 如何将表模式和约束复制到不同数据库的表?
所属栏目:[MsSql教程] 日期:2021-01-20 热度:108
可以使用哪些SQL将指定表的模式复制到不同数据库中的表? 解决方法 SELECT INTO将创建具有相同模式的新表.所以你可以: SELECT * INTO newdb.dbo.newtable FROM olddb.dbo.oldtable 要只复制架构而不是数据: SELECT TOP 0 * INTO newdb.dbo.newtable FROM[详细]
-
sql – Oracle 10g中的Pivot / Crosstab查询(动态列号)
所属栏目:[MsSql教程] 日期:2021-01-20 热度:190
我有这个表视图 UserName Product NumberPurchaces-------- ------- ---------------'John Doe' 'Chair' 4'John Doe' 'Table' 1'Jane Doe' 'Table' 2'Jane Doe' 'Bed' 1 如何在Oracle 10g中创建将提供此数据透视视图的查询? UserName Chair Table Bed ---[详细]